    As I am a new member I thought some of you might be interested in what I do...

    I am 23 and studying my Masters in Digital Performance in South Yorkshire, Doncaster, UK.

    I work with dancers, actors, DJ's, and composers to devise and/or help develop interactive, intermedia performances. Myself I am very much into the visual side of performance. I use graphical media and create anything from interactive wallpapers to interactive motion tracking driven elements within a performance.
